Transaction cc53b2b9504767109851a90d36bd2058f075a74885379157f23f1dd1886b2986
1 Input
1 Output
-
cc53b2b9504767109851a90d36bd2058f075a74885379157f23f1dd1886b2986:0
- value
- 21321653
- script pubkey
- OP_0 OP_PUSHBYTES_20 628094853cba68cb5196a453c6c3dc72eb1ea37b
- address
- ltc1qv2qffpfuhf5vk5vk53fuds7uwt43agmmfzvz9m